Sen. Warren and Rep. Cummings Forum Asks for Student Debt Feedback

Today, the Middle Class Prosperity Project held a forum on “Tackling the Student Debt Crisis.” Sen. Elizabeth Warren and Rep. Elijah E. Cummings hosted panelists at University of Massachusetts in Boston to discuss how the increasing cost of college and student loan debt are threatening the American middle class. The panel comes on the heels of Sen. Warren reintroducing her student loan refinancing bill. Panelists included the chancellor of UMass Boston, the director of the Student Loan Borrower Assistance Project at NCLC, the CFPB Student Loan Ombudsman, and a Harvard professor of education and economics.

Additionally, parent and student loan borrowers spoke to the challenges and hardships they are facing. It was an emotional panel where students spoke to their personal debt and how it will follow them for a long time following graduation. Sen. Warren and Rep. Cummings are pioneering the fight to tackle student debt, and were appreciative of panelists’ testimony.
